Carrying Along Collin

Carrying Along Collin: Jillian and Olivia MosesCollin County kids are looking for facts in all the right places this summer. They are hitting the trail to local museums and libraries in pursuit of answers to historical questions about Collin County. And they won’t be alone: they’re carrying along cut-outs of Collin McKinney, one of our first settlers and the namesake of the county and county seat. This “Carry Along Collin” folder is a child’s passport to learning and fun as they visit ten different Collin County museums for validation stamps and the answers to questions such as:

“Preston Road, a busy highway today, was once a good route for early settlers. Name this original trail that once saw migrating buffalo and traveling Indians.”

“Carry Along Collin” is a summer project of the Collin County Historical Commission to promote student understanding of their local history. Materials are available at all Collin County libraries. At their first museum visit, kids will also get a button with a likeness of Collin McKinney that says “Collin County Trailblazer.”
